I have split them into two categories the first being how I feel I have been influenced and the second being how I feel I have influenced others. Conformity Conformity is a form of social influence. Conforming is where you go along with others even thought sometimes you know you are correct. M.Sherif (Lights in Dark) M. Sherif used the 'auto kinetic' effect- a visual illusion in which a stationary dot of light appears to move when shown in a very dark room. Participants were taken into the room alone and were asked how much they thought that the light was moving. The answers varied from 2-25cm. Then the group went in to the room
